Verizon HTC Droid Eris Android-powered Mobile to Launch HTC Droid Eris Specs Confirmed, Release Date Soon

Verizon Wireless is keen on having the best offer for Android-powered
handsets this year. Apparently not just one mobile phone but a complete
lineup for the company's Android devices, there's a new smartphone
coming to the Droid series — the new HTC Droid Eris.

Previously known as HTC Desire, the newly branded Droid Eris with the
luscious Sense UI is slated to launch on November 6th. Unfortunately
there's a 528MHz Qualcomm CPU under the hood and Android 1.5 —
although we'd expect an upgrade to 2.0 Eclair sometime next year.
